What is the High-Frequency Word Inventory Form?

The High-Frequency Word Inventory Form serves as a structured tool for educators to monitor student progress in word recognition. This form incorporates sections for the first, second, and third hundred high-frequency words, enabling teachers to effectively track how well students recognize these essential words. The word recognition template facilitates ongoing assessments and fosters literacy development.
